  • Title: [Nonribosomal ribonucleoprotein particles in preparations of nonhistone proteins extracted from pigeon erythroblast chromatin].
    Author: Stvolinskaia NS, Fedina AB, Gazarian GG.
    Journal: Mol Biol (Mosk); 1978; 12(5):1023-7. PubMed ID: 739990.
    Abstract:
    Two proteins were isolated from preparations of weakly bound nonhistone proteins, obtained from highly purified chromatin with 0.35 M NaCl. These two protein residues from chromatin RNP-particles have the buoyant density of 1.41 g/cm3 as shown by centrifugation in CsCl gradients and contain heterogeneous fast labelling nuclear RNA. According to SDS pol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is the molecular weights of these proteins are 70000 and 43000 daltons.
